The Goodhope sub council learnt this week that the unknown projects constitute those with beneficiaries that could not be reached during the monitoring process.
“Some of these businesses failed mainly due to drought, lack of commitment from the youth, youth leaving their projects for permanent jobs, shortage of water, and the inability of poultry projects to penetrate the market as they compete with large and already established suppliers,” the Sub council chairperson Mmaobene Molefe said.
